In the realm of organic chemistry, various functional groups play crucial roles in determining the properties and behaviors of different compounds. One such group is the hexyl, which refers to a hydrocarbon chain consisting of six carbon atoms. The hexyl group is derived from hexane, a straight-chain alkane with the formula C6H14. Understanding the structure and applications of the hexyl group can provide insights into its significance in both industrial and laboratory settings.The hexyl group is often encountered in the synthesis of various chemical compounds, including pharmaceuticals, plastics, and fragrances. For example, when a hexyl group is attached to a benzene ring, it forms hexylbenzene, an aromatic hydrocarbon that can be used as a solvent or in the production of other chemicals. This versatility makes the hexyl group an important building block in organic synthesis.Moreover, the presence of the hexyl group can significantly influence the physical properties of a compound. Compounds containing hexyl chains tend to have lower melting and boiling points compared to their longer-chain counterparts. This behavior is attributed to the hydrophobic nature of the hexyl group, which affects solubility and volatility. For instance, hexyl alcohol is a common solvent in laboratories due to its ability to dissolve a wide range of substances while maintaining a relatively low boiling point.In addition to its use in solvents, the hexyl group is also found in various consumer products. Many cosmetics and personal care items contain hexyl derivatives, as they can enhance texture and stability. For example, hexyl palmitate is a common ingredient in lotions and creams, providing a smooth application and moisturizing properties. Understanding how the hexyl group interacts with other ingredients can help formulators create more effective and appealing products.Furthermore, the environmental impact of hexyl compounds has garnered attention in recent years. Some hexyl derivatives are being studied for their potential effects on aquatic ecosystems. Research indicates that certain hexyl compounds can be toxic to marine life, raising concerns about their widespread use in industrial applications. As a result, there is a growing emphasis on developing greener alternatives that minimize the ecological footprint of hexyl chemicals.In conclusion, the hexyl group plays a vital role in organic chemistry, contributing to the synthesis and functionality of various compounds. Its unique properties make it valuable in multiple industries, from pharmaceuticals to cosmetics. However, as we continue to explore the applications of hexyl derivatives, it is essential to consider their environmental implications. By balancing innovation with sustainability, we can harness the benefits of the hexyl group while minimizing its impact on our planet.
